Hubert Weckbach

Hubert Weckbach (born October 28, 1935 in Rippberg ; † March 19, 2018 ) was a German archivist . From 1961 to 1997 he was deputy director of the Heilbronn City Archives and published a large number of essays and monographs, mainly on the history of Heilbronn .

Life

Weckbach graduated from the Theodor-Heuss-Gymnasium Heilbronn and entered in 1956 as a candidate for the senior archive service at the city of Heilbronn . After a delegation to the main state archive in Stuttgart in 1958/59 and a visit to the archive school in Marburg in 1959/60, he passed the diploma examination for senior archive service with distinction and then returned to the Heilbronn city archive, of which he was deputy director from 1961. Together with its long-time director (1963–1991) Helmut Schmolz , Weckbach shaped the development of the city archive, which moved twice during this time. In addition to the ongoing archival work, he was involved in the conception and development of the archive's exhibitions and wrote, mostly together with Schmolz, fundamental works on the city's history. In addition, he wrote a large number of essays on local history, designed illustrated books and edited other publications in the city archive. In total, his catalog raisonné includes almost 250 numbers.

Many of Weckbach's essays appeared in the local history supplement of the daily newspaper Heilbronner Demokratie , Schwaben und Franken , whose editorial support was also his responsibility. Together with Helmut Schmolz, he was the editor of the yearbook for Swabian-Franconian history published by the Heilbronn Historical Association , in which he also published. He was secretary and committee member in the historical association for over 20 years. When he retired in 1997 with the rank of City Archives Councilor (since 1990) after 41 years of service, he was the Heilbronn archivist with the longest term in office.
